I am trying to use xsltproc to build a website as described in
docbook.sourceforge.net/release/website/example/buildmake.html.
xsltproc always tries to download the dtd's. I checked
/etc/sgml/docbook-website.cat and it contains:
CATALOG /usr/share/sgml/docbook/custom/website/2.0b1/catalog
I checked /usr/share/sgml/docbook/custom/website/2.0b1/catalog and it
contains:
PUBLIC "-//Norman Walsh//DTD Website V2.0b1//EN" "website.dtd"
PUBLIC "-//Norman Walsh//DTD Website V2.0//EN" "website.dtd"
...and so on.
/usr/share/sgml/docbook/custom/website/2.0b1/website.dtd exists.
So the catalogs are here but I cannot seem to have xsltproc access
them. I tried invoking it with the --docbook option and the
--catalogs option (after having set and exported $SGML_CATALOG_FILES
both to /etc/sgml/docbook-website.cat and
/usr/share/sgml/docbook/custom/website/2.0b1/catalog) with no success.
What am I missing?
